Selecting roofing materials and installers

 
   

Roofing products vary a lot, roofing installers are not all alike and price shouldn't be the only criterion when choosing a contractor or a roof coating or other reflective product.

A too low cost isn’t usually a good option. Quality and professionalism are more important than price alone…

Qualified roofing products

In USA and Canada you may select a qualified Energy Star roof product. Energy Star qualified products are a guarantee of quality, since they meet minimum standards of quality, including a new solar reflectance values.


Choosing an installer

Pay attention to the roofing installer issue. The contractor should ensure proper installation in order to get proper waterproofing and maximum durability and solar reflectance to the roof…

A good roof installer has experience, and specialized knowledge and training. The National Roofing Contractors Association recommends:

- a well-established installer;
- a professional comfortable with the new trends of the roofing industry (like the trends involving solar reflectance and new products);
- an affiliated installer (member of local, regional, state and national industry associations);
- a licensed contractor, bonded with insurance companies;
- a contractor that is a licensed or an approved applicator of roofing manufacturers;
- an installer that offers a good warranty covering both workmanship and materials;
- an installer offering references and proofs of completed projects and a list of recent works and clients;
- an installer capable of clearly explaining his project and his procedures.

Do not forget to ask to the installer a written proposal, sufficiently detailed, including starting and completion dates, payment terms or damage prevention procedures; request also the name and habilitations of the person who will be in charge of the project.

The National Roofing Contractors Association (NRCA) provides lists of regional roofing Contractors, in the case of USA.
